OWI Drinking and Driving Classes. 
For  those arrested for OWI or Zero Tolerance in Iowa, attendance at a state-approved course for drinking drivers is mandatory prior to reinstatement of the driver's license.  

Below are community colleges and treatment agencies closest to Clayton County that offer the Drinking Drivers Classes.  The standard tuition charge of the 12 hour course is $115.00, which includes required text book.
